Big step back from the previous generation
I wanted to give these a fair shake before reviewing, and after 2 months of use they still work (i.e. they play sounds into my ears) but they're just not as good as the previous gen for a few reasons: First, the startup time. I never timed them for specifics but the previous gen Earbuds could be connected and playing from the case within a few seconds. These take an astonishingly long time to connect and start, which is extremely apparent when playing a video and pulling the Earbuds out of the case and popping them into your ear. In this situation there will always be a few seconds of no audio from either the device or the earbuds while the video still plays, a problem that simply did not exist on the previous gen. Hardly a life-ruining issue but it is extremely annoying to have this knowing it did not happen with the previous gen. The multi-device connect thing is completely and totally useless. I have an iPhone and an iPad that I use with these, and I've seen no point at all for the multi-device connection. When both are connected, I can play from one device and not the other, and it seems like the only way to switch which device is playing is to disconnect the first one, defeating the point of the multi-device connection in the first place! What it does do is allow both devices to connect (previous gen required me to disable the bluetooth on the device I wasn't using to have them connect to the correct one), but this always results in the un-used device disconnecting constantly when out of range. This leads to the same issue as the startup time above, where there will be a few seconds of silence while I hear "DISCONNECTED" from the device I'm not using. The big issue, and the one I despise above all other things about these earbuds is the touch controls. The previous gen had buttons that you could hear a "click" when the button was pressed. This was GREAT because you knew you'd pressed the button. Want to pause? Click twice. Increase volume, click once. With these, I tap them and I never know if it's going to work or not. Two taps might stop a video, but it might not register the first tap and now my volume's higher. Three taps for the next song has resulted in stopping the music on a registered double-tap. Add on the input lag is so long that volume changes could take a while to register, and suddenly a second tap to get a volume change stops the video. Don't get me started on how many times I've reached up to adjust them and made the audio louder. The button was a feature that worked flawlessly on the previous gen, so the change to touch controls is a perfect example of "If it ain't broke, don't fix it!" Flaws an annoyances aside, they do still work and they hold a charge for a long time and the audio does sound really nice. However, all of the changes to this generation of Everyday Earbuds is such that I doubt I consider Raycon again in the future. The older ones were simple and they worked well every time, these do something annoying every single time I use them, and I'm reminded of how good that old generation was every time I pick up this pair.
